Background
Catherine Elizabeth Czyz, proceeding pro se, appealed from a decision of the Circuit Court for the Fifteenth Judicial Circuit in Palm Beach County. The circuit court proceeding was assigned to Judge Carolyn Ruth Bell under case number 502024CA000996XXXAMB.
The appellees included Mark Elliot Zuckerberg, Meta Platforms, Inc., and Blogger, Inc. The Fourth District’s opinion does not describe Czyz’s claims, the circuit court’s ruling, the facts underlying the dispute, or the issues presented on appeal.
The Court’s Holding
The Fourth District Court of Appeal affirmed the circuit court’s decision in a per curiam opinion. Judges Ciklin, Conner, and Klingensmith concurred.
The court provided no reasoning or discussion of the merits. Accordingly, the opinion establishes only that the judgment or order under review was affirmed; it does not identify the legal ground supporting that result.
